Indiana SB 474 (2023) — Home health agencies.

Allows a home health agency to: (1) provide services in any county in Indiana; and (2) satisfy supervising home health aide services requirements by complying with federal law. Allows: (1) the Indiana department of health (state department) to adopt rules concerning the oversight and supervision of the services a home health agency provides in noncontiguous counties; and (2) the state health commissioner to waive rules adopted concerning home health agencies if certain conditions are met. Provides that a home health agency is not required to conduct a preemployment physical on a job applicant before the individual has contact with a home health agency patient. Allows a registered home health aide to administer gastrointestinal and jejunostomy tube feedings to a specific patient if specified conditions are met. Requires the state department to approve at least one training curriculum concerning the administration of tube feedings. Repeals laws concerning drug testing of home health agency employees.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2023-01-19 Authored by Senators Becker and Johnson
  • 2023-01-19 First reading: referred to Committee on Health and Provider Services reading-1, referral-committee
  • 2023-01-30 Senator Charbonneau added as coauthor
  • 2023-02-02 Committee report: amend do pass, adopted committee-passage
  • 2023-02-06 Second reading: ordered engrossed reading-2
  • 2023-02-07 Third reading: passed; Roll Call 88: yeas 48, nays 0 passage, reading-3, reading-3
  • 2023-02-07 House sponsor: Representative Ledbetter
  • 2023-02-07 Senator Randolph added as coauthor
  • 2023-02-09 Referred to the House referral
  • 2023-02-28 First reading: referred to Committee on Public Health reading-1, referral-committee
  • 2023-04-10 Representative Barrett added as cosponsor
  • 2023-04-11 Committee report: do pass, adopted committee-passage
  • 2023-04-13 Second reading: ordered engrossed reading-2
  • 2023-04-17 Third reading: passed; Roll Call 437: yeas 97, nays 1 passage, reading-3, reading-3
  • 2023-04-18 Returned to the Senate without amendments receipt
  • 2023-04-18 Senator Tomes added as coauthor
  • 2023-04-21 Signed by the President Pro Tempore passage
  • 2023-04-24 Signed by the Speaker passage
  • 2023-04-26 Signed by the President of the Senate passage
  • 2023-05-01 Signed by the Governor executive-signature
  • 2023-05-01 Public Law 117 became-law
